Abstract
This paper explores the application of video disc digital storage technology to cruise missiles. A brief summary of current and near term video disc data storage technology is provided and then several cruise missile mission applications which depend on the availability of an onboard storage system capable of storing 10-100 billion bits of data are discussed.
